Review of 2010 Hero Honda Super Splendor 125
The Hero Honda Super Splendor 125, launched in 2010, stands out as a reliable and efficient commuter motorcycle that caters to a wide array of riders. With its robust 125cc engine, the bike delivers a commendable balance of power and fuel efficiency, making it an ideal choice for daily commuting. Its sleek, modern design appeals to both young and mature riders, while the comfortable seating position ensures a pleasant riding experience even during long journeys. Additionally, the Super Splendor is equipped with features such as a reliable drum brake system and a durable chassis, which enhance its overall safety and stability on the road. Value-wise, the Hero Honda Super Splendor 125 is known for its low maintenance costs and excellent resale value, making it a smart investment for budget-conscious consumers. Its reputation for reliability and fuel efficiency has garnered a loyal following, contributing to its popularity in the crowded commuter market. Overall, the 2010 Super Splendor exemplifies Hero Honda's commitment to producing motorcycles that combine quality, performance, and affordability, solidifying its position as a top choice for everyday riders seeking practicality without compromising on style or comfort.

Disadvantages
- Performance Limitations: While the Super Splendor is designed for fuel efficiency, its performance may feel underwhelming for riders seeking more power or acceleration, especially on highways or during overtaking.
- Basic Features: The 2010 model lacks many modern features that are common in newer motorcycles, such as digital displays, advanced braking systems (like ABS), and enhanced suspension setups, which could detract from the overall riding experience.
- Vibration Issues: Some riders have reported vibrations at higher speeds, which can lead to discomfort on longer rides. This can be particularly noticeable on rougher road surfaces.
- Limited Styling Options: The design may be considered a bit conservative or outdated compared to more contemporary models, which could be a drawback for riders looking for a more stylish or sporty appearance.
- Suspension Setup: The suspension, while adequate for city commuting, may not provide the best handling on uneven or bumpy roads, affecting ride comfort and stability under certain conditions. These factors might influence a buyer's decision, especially when compared to more modern offerings in the market.
